Tanker, Airlift, and Special Mission

TASM

TASM

A PC-based aircraft/weapons/electronic countermeasures (A/W/E) component that integrates mission planning with aircraft-specific planning and data load capabilities. The A/W/E expands the current portable flight planning system capabilities by providing a framework to support unique requirements for a variety of users in a cost effective approach.

Benefits:

  • Standardized user interface for common look and feel
  • Reusable, common components to reduce life cycle costs
  • Plug and play architecture for ease of upgrades
  • Customizable to user-specific needs
  • Integrates with other planning and EW/IW/CC systems

Features:

  • Windows 95, NT and 2000 compatible
  • GATM-compliant navigation data server (future)
  • Customized data editors and tools to calculate mission data and replicate aircraft mission computer data entry fields
  • Drag-and-drop file selection for mission data uploaded to aircraft
  • Flight plan and navigation output file generation and transfer
  • Drag-and-drop data map overlays to display routes, NIMA DAFIF data, custom data, draw files
  • ECHUM displays with ability to create or select points as custom data points
  • Graphical creation and editing of displayed data
  • CADRG, DTED and CIB map backgrounds
  • A/W/E-specific, custom data creation and selection
  • Import and graphical filtering of navigation data
    – User-specified queries of NIMA DAFIF data
    – Graphical display of query results
  • Airdrop planning
  • Air refueling planning
  • Take-off and landing data (TOLD)
  • Message window depicting informational, warning, error and GATM messages
  • HTML-based help with video clips

Current aircraft supported:

  • C-5, C-9, C-17, C-130J, KC-10, KC-135R/E/D, E-3, E-8, OC-135 and (N)KC-135
